Additionally, the Deed of Extrajudicial Settlement of Estate must be notarized and submitted with the Register of Deeds. The Deed will have to even be published inside a newspaper of standard circulation as soon as weekly for three consecutive weeks. Otherwise, the settlement won't be regarded valid.

Be aware that only a sound will can disinherit Compulsory Heirs and this will should endure Probate with an Inheritance Lawyer. Notice also that it is tough to disinherit – you will find incredibly particular grounds you can use.
